Yamanokami Junmai Kingaku is a pure rice sake from Kuramoto Shuzo in Nara, named Yamanokami (mountain deity), a reference to the Shinto deity of sake brewing revered at Miwa Shrine in Nara. Brewed without added alcohol, this junmai carries spiritual and historical resonance from one of Japan's most sacred sake-producing regions.
